This isn't exactly **peak** ZIM, but it is definitely ZIM. By that, I guess I mean, the television show at its best moments was better than this movie was overall, but this movie overall still absolutely remained faithful to the television show. Within minutes I felt transported back to my youth, watching the ZIM series as a teenager. It's not my favourite part of the franchise, but it 100% captures the spirit of why I loved it to begin with. This may cause a whole new generation of kids to get railed on for thinking GIR is fun, but maybe if we could just let people enjoy things this time around that might be nice. _Final rating:★★★½ - I really liked it.
